Alfalfa pellets are a great addition to a horse's diet to increase the calories.
They can be fed in conjunction with almost any other feed, including beet pulp or alfalfa cubes.
If fed with a long-stem fiber source (grass/pasture, beet pulp, alfalfa cubes) they can be used to replace calories lost when hay is scarce or unavailable, but they cannot be used alone to completely safely replace hay.
